Using datasets from the Internet for hydrological modeling: an example from the Kucuk Menderes Basin, Turkey
Public domain datasets are freely available on the Internet are easy to obtain, and often more up-to-date than those from local sources. This simplifies the modeling process and increases the ability to model basins anywhere in the world, from anywhere with Internet access. Although not all types of data are available, and some conversions may be needed, the information provided does allow for quick and easy simulations of basins. The Semi-Distributed Land-Use Runoff Process (SLURP) hydrological model has been designed to take advantage of such data sources.

Urban wastewater and agricultural reuse challenges in India
More than 1 million hectares of urban land in India could be irrigated for crops if wastewater was made safe for use. Lack of systematic data collection by municipalities makes it difficult to accurately assess the wastewater generation or estimate the total amount of urban area under wastewater irrigation, so the potential of urban and peri-urban farming could be even greater.
Using remote sensing techniques to evaluate lining efficacy of watercourses
Studies the low-cost alternative strategy of selective lining of watercourses to reduce seepage and increase irrigated areas in the Indian subcontinent. Satellite remote-sensing (SRS) is seen as a cost-effective evaluation tool in view of its large area of synoptic and repetitive coverage.

Use of decision support systems to improve dam planning and dam operation in Africa.
After a hiatus in dam investment, through the 1990s and the early part of this century, construction of large dams is increasing again. Modern decision support systems can usefully input to this process by guiding the analysis of complicated hydrological, environmental, social and economic factors associated with water allocation and assessing the impact of different, often conflicting, management options both in planning and operation of dams. This publication highlights the constructive role that decision support systems can play in planning and operation of dams.

Urban wastewater reuse for crop production in the water-short Guanajuato River Basin, Mexico
From a river-basin perspective, wastewater irrigation is an important form of water and nutrient reuse; however, there are important water quality, environmental, and public health considerations. This report explores the advantages and risks of urban wastewater reuse for crop production in the water-short Guanajuato river-basin in west-central Mexico, and then by a selective literature review demonstrates how common this practice is worldwide.
